Liaison Apple TV+ ● New Series

This new six-episode thriller starring French actors Vincent Cassel (Westworld) and Eva Green (Penny Dreadful) is a high-stakes contempora­ry drama exploring how the mistakes of the past can destroy the future. It’s the first French- and English-language Apple TV+ original. Episodes drop on Fridays.

Call Me Chihiro Netflix ● Original Film

Based on the 2013-18 Japanese manga Chihiro-san, this drama tells the story of a former sex worker named Chihiro (Kasumi Arimura), who works at a small bento (take-out meal) shop in a seaside town. There, she interacts with people whose mental scars and struggles leave them unable to live happily, and her words and actions influence each person’s way of living.

Outer Banks Netflix ● Season Premiere

In Season 3 of the teen action/mystery drama, after losing the gold and fleeing the Outer Banks, the Pogues have washed ashore on a desert island that, for a brief moment, seems like an idyllic home. But things quickly go south for the group when they find themselves once again caught up in a race for the treasure and running for their lives.

Bel-Air Peacock ● Season Premiere

Season 2 of this hourlong dramatic reimaginin­g of the ’90s sitcom The Fresh Prince of Bel-Air picks up with Will (Jabari Banks) at a crossroads as a new figure comes into his life who challenges what he’s learned in Bel-Air and competes for control of his influence.

Law & Order: Special Victims Unit NBC, 9 p.m.

Three-time Emmy winner Bradley Whitford plays a neurologis­t with earlyonset dementia who confesses to a murder. For the first time, the crime show reveals a suspect’s backstory in flashbacks as the truth comes out.
